The research, published in <a href=\"https:\/\/www.nature.com\/articles\/s41467-023-37554-1\" target=\"_blank\" rel=\"noopener\" title=\"\"><em>Nature Communications<\/em><\/a>, used extreme value statistics and large datasets from climate models and observations to identify regions where temperature records are most likely to be broken soonest and where communities are in the greatest danger of experiencing extreme heat. Regions including Afghanistan, Papua New Guinea, Central America, Beijing, and Central Europe are highlighted as hotspots, as record-breaking heatwaves could have severe consequences for their densely populated areas with limited healthcare and energy provision.<\/p>\n\n\n<div class=\"wp-block-image\">\n<figure class=\"aligncenter size-large is-resized\"><img  loading=\"lazy\"  decoding=\"async\"  src=\"data:image\/png;base64,iVBORw0KGgoAAAANSUhEUgAAAAEAAAABAQMAAAAl21bKAAAAA1BMVEUAAP+KeNJXAAAAAXRSTlMAQObYZgAAAAlwSFlzAAAOxAAADsQBlSsOGwAAAApJREFUCNdjYAAAAAIAAeIhvDMAAAAASUVORK5CYII=\"  alt=\"\"  class=\"wp-image-6253 pk-lazyload\"  width=\"800\"  height=\"533\"  data-pk-sizes=\"auto\"  data-pk-src=\"https:\/\/modernsciences.org\/staging\/4414\/wp-content\/uploads\/2023\/04\/image-15-1024x683.png\" ><figcaption class=\"wp-element-caption\">(<a href=\"https:\/\/www.pexels.com\/@timmossholder\/\" target=\"_blank\" rel=\"noopener\" title=\"\">Mossholder<\/a>\/<a href=\"https:\/\/www.pexels.com\/\" target=\"_blank\" rel=\"noopener\" title=\"\">Pexels<\/a>, 2021)<\/figcaption><\/figure>\n<\/div>\n\n\n<p class=\"wp-block-paragraph\">The study suggests that countries yet to experience the most intense heatwaves are especially susceptible, as adaptation measures are often only introduced after the event. A high chance of record-breaking temperatures, growing populations, and limited healthcare and energy provision increases the risks. The researchers also cautioned that statistically implausible extremes, when current records are broken by margins that seemed impossible until they occurred, could happen anywhere. These unlikely events were found to have transpired in almost a third (31%) of the regions assessed between 1959 and 2021, such as the 2021 Western North America heatwave.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Lead author, climate scientist <a href=\"https:\/\/vikki-thompson.github.io\/\" target=\"_blank\" rel=\"noopener\" title=\"\">Dr. Vikki Thompson<\/a>, has called for policymakers in hotspot regions to consider appropriate action plans to reduce the risk of deaths and associated harms from climate extremes.
